diff options
-rw-r--r-- | .SRCINFO | 20 | ||||
-rw-r--r-- | PKGBUILD | 23 | ||||
-rw-r--r-- | java.desktop | 8 | ||||
-rw-r--r-- | jconsole.desktop | 8 | ||||
-rw-r--r-- | jdk.install | 4 | ||||
-rw-r--r-- | jshell.desktop | 8 |
6 files changed, 40 insertions, 31 deletions
@@ -1,28 +1,28 @@ pkgbase = jdk pkgdesc = Oracle Java Development Kit - pkgver = 11.0.2 + pkgver = 12 pkgrel = 1 url = https://www.oracle.com/java/ install = jdk.install arch = x86_64 license = custom depends = java-environment-common - depends = jre>=11 - depends = jre<12 + depends = jre>=12 + depends = jre<13 depends = zlib depends = hicolor-icon-theme - provides = java-environment=11 - provides = java-environment-jdk=11 - source = https://download.oracle.com/otn-pub/java/jdk/11.0.2+9/f51449fcd52f4d52b93a989c5c56ed3c/jdk-11.0.2_linux-x64_bin.tar.gz + provides = java-environment=12 + provides = java-environment-jdk=12 + source = https://download.oracle.com/otn-pub/java/jdk/12+33/312335d836a34c7c8bba9d963e26dc23/jdk-12_linux-x64_bin.tar.gz source = java.desktop source = jconsole.desktop source = jshell.desktop source = java_16.png source = java_48.png - sha256sums = 7b4fd8ffcf53e9ff699d964a80e4abf9706b5bdb5644a765c2b96f99e3a2cdc8 - sha256sums = 1052634cdcbf50ca14b864b58f3afa53de1706bdc9c593667c29974146212c54 - sha256sums = 9a84d1b4dd969e867b2dbb6df0d0c44814729e0f1d0c61ab6c54d676eae83b3b - sha256sums = 73d686fd6e478a887a51451d7ada7c045f31ce299f65f45e50a793820ee99d85 + sha256sums = 183d4d897bbf47bdae43b2bb4fc0465a9178209b5250555ac7fdb8fab6cc43a6 + sha256sums = 7b348c5f6b6ce7df7f849a90f0bdbbdb5a2d6236ec05e96e0b160755cf87fd69 + sha256sums = 74d52ebc46e1d6b104130c04209a9cf318163de022034239042a1981a6ffd60f + sha256sums = d207bb3f4a55e329546d084d8b82b6c217177ff11ebcc85e6420b14b011b3cd1 sha256sums = d27fec1d74f7a3081c3d175ed184d15383666dc7f02cc0f7126f11549879c6ed sha256sums = 7cf8ca096e6d6e425b3434446b0835537d0fc7fe64b3ccba7a55f7bd86c7e176 @@ -2,9 +2,9 @@ # Contributor: Det <nimetonmaili g-mail> pkgname=jdk -pkgver=11.0.2 -_build=9 -_hash=f51449fcd52f4d52b93a989c5c56ed3c +pkgver=12 +_build=33 +_hash=312335d836a34c7c8bba9d963e26dc23 _majver="${pkgver%%.*}" _next="$((_majver + 1))" pkgrel=1 @@ -21,10 +21,10 @@ source=("https://download.oracle.com/otn-pub/java/jdk/${pkgver}+${_build}/${_has 'jshell.desktop' 'java_16.png' 'java_48.png') -sha256sums=('7b4fd8ffcf53e9ff699d964a80e4abf9706b5bdb5644a765c2b96f99e3a2cdc8' - '1052634cdcbf50ca14b864b58f3afa53de1706bdc9c593667c29974146212c54' - '9a84d1b4dd969e867b2dbb6df0d0c44814729e0f1d0c61ab6c54d676eae83b3b' - '73d686fd6e478a887a51451d7ada7c045f31ce299f65f45e50a793820ee99d85' +sha256sums=('183d4d897bbf47bdae43b2bb4fc0465a9178209b5250555ac7fdb8fab6cc43a6' + '7b348c5f6b6ce7df7f849a90f0bdbbdb5a2d6236ec05e96e0b160755cf87fd69' + '74d52ebc46e1d6b104130c04209a9cf318163de022034239042a1981a6ffd60f' + 'd207bb3f4a55e329546d084d8b82b6c217177ff11ebcc85e6420b14b011b3cd1' 'd27fec1d74f7a3081c3d175ed184d15383666dc7f02cc0f7126f11549879c6ed' '7cf8ca096e6d6e425b3434446b0835537d0fc7fe64b3ccba7a55f7bd86c7e176') @@ -61,6 +61,15 @@ package() { install -D -m644 "${srcdir}/java_16.png" "${pkgdir}/usr/share/icons/hicolor/16x16/apps/java${_majver}-jdk.png" install -D -m644 "${srcdir}/java_48.png" "${pkgdir}/usr/share/icons/hicolor/48x48/apps/java${_majver}-jdk.png" + # man pages + local _file + for _file in man/man1/* + do + install -D -m644 "$_file" "${pkgdir}/usr/share/${_file%.1}-jdk${_majver}.1" + done + rm "${pkgdir}/usr/share/man/man1/"{java,jjs,jrunscript,keytool,pack200}-jdk"${_majver}".1 + rm "${pkgdir}/usr/share/man/man1/"{rmid,rmiregistry,unpack200}-jdk"${_majver}".1 + # legal/licenses cp -a legal/* "${pkgdir}/usr/share/licenses/${pkgname}" ln -s "$pkgname" "${pkgdir}/usr/share/licenses/java${_majver}-${pkgname}" diff --git a/java.desktop b/java.desktop index 1c3cf4e50abe..bf14d3517c40 100644 --- a/java.desktop +++ b/java.desktop @@ -1,10 +1,10 @@ [Desktop Entry] -Name=Oracle Java 11 Runtime -Comment=Oracle Java 11 Runtime +Name=Oracle Java 12 Runtime +Comment=Oracle Java 12 Runtime Keywords=java;runtime -Exec=/usr/lib/jvm/java-11-jdk/bin/java -jar +Exec=/usr/lib/jvm/java-12-jdk/bin/java -jar Terminal=false Type=Application -Icon=java11-jdk +Icon=java12-jdk MimeType=application/x-java-archive;application/java-archive;application/x-jar; NoDisplay=true diff --git a/jconsole.desktop b/jconsole.desktop index f2b689b9b2fc..4b73c8ddcf85 100644 --- a/jconsole.desktop +++ b/jconsole.desktop @@ -1,9 +1,9 @@ [Desktop Entry] -Name=Oracle Java 11 Console -Comment=Oracle Java 11 Monitoring and Management Console +Name=Oracle Java 12 Console +Comment=Oracle Java 12 Monitoring and Management Console Keywords=java;console;monitoring -Exec=/usr/lib/jvm/java-11-jdk/bin/jconsole +Exec=/usr/lib/jvm/java-12-jdk/bin/jconsole Terminal=false Type=Application -Icon=java11-jdk +Icon=java12-jdk Categories=Application;System; diff --git a/jdk.install b/jdk.install index e8adb3282b54..df31ceffe439 100644 --- a/jdk.install +++ b/jdk.install @@ -1,4 +1,4 @@ -THIS_JDK='java-11-jdk' +THIS_JDK='java-12-jdk' fix_default() { if [ ! -x /usr/bin/java ]; then @@ -42,7 +42,7 @@ post_upgrade() { pre_remove() { if [ "x$(fix_default)" = "x${THIS_JDK}" ]; then - # Check JRE11 is still available + # Check JRE12 is still available if [ -x /usr/lib/jvm/${THIS_JDK}/bin/java ]; then /usr/bin/archlinux-java unset fi diff --git a/jshell.desktop b/jshell.desktop index 83fb1edf95e4..e166068579ba 100644 --- a/jshell.desktop +++ b/jshell.desktop @@ -1,9 +1,9 @@ [Desktop Entry] -Name=Oracle Java 11 Shell -Comment=Oracle Java 11 Shell +Name=Oracle Java 12 Shell +Comment=Oracle Java 12 Shell Keywords=java;shell -Exec=/usr/lib/jvm/java-11-jdk/bin/jshell +Exec=/usr/lib/jvm/java-12-jdk/bin/jshell Terminal=true Type=Application -Icon=java11-jdk +Icon=java12-jdk Categories=Application;System; |